Onboarding: Inkflow rendering pipeline. Inkflow converts authored markdown into sanitized HTML through three stages — parse, transform, emit. Plugins live in the transforms directory and run in the order listed in pipeline.toml. Local setup: install dependencies, run the fixture suite, and confirm all golden files match. The emit stage publishes rendered output to the Pressbin asset store, which requires authentication. Create your .env from the sample file and add the Pressbin publish key on the following line.

secret setting of yagef-baweg: RELAY_SECRET29=cb53deb59a49ed54d9f43599b54ca

Step 4: Switch StageGrid to the vector renderer. After upgrading the Pellway Theatre seat-map service to StageGrid 3.x, the legacy raster tiles are no longer generated, so any cached seat maps must be purged before the first render. Support agents should expect a brief blank-map state while the cache rebuilds; this is normal and resolves within a minute. Confirm the renderer host is reachable, then apply the settings exactly as shipped. The current production configuration is as follows.

config for tadug-yahig:
[casir]
team = druys
access_code = ac_250d5c
host = casir.halixstack.local
port = 5672
owner = praeth.wenax
peer = rusvan.crelvodata.example

Hello, and welcome aboard. I'm handing you the release pipeline for Fuelgauge, the fleet fuel-usage report used by the Tarnwick depot team. The monthly build aggregates telematics data, renders the PDF pack, and publishes it to the ops portal. Everything is automated except the final publish, which we gate manually because depot managers act on these numbers directly. Check the variance summary before publishing; anything over 8% needs a note. The publish step won't run unsigned, so sign the bundle with the key below.

release key, kawif-hawep: bky13_X7TGuRG4Zu4ZJ

## Service Accounts — LiftSim Dispatch

LiftSim's dispatch simulator runs under the `liftsim-dispatch` service account. Scope: read-only access to the CarState feed, write access to queue metrics. No human login permitted. Rotation every 90 days, enforced by the Vantry scheduler. Audit events land in the Halden log sink. The account authenticates against the internal sim gateway using the key below.

app token of bahaf-tajeg = zpat23_SjjsllwiLmXbtS65veZaV47